Manu Bhaker (born 18 February 2002) is an Indian sport shooter. She gained wide recognition after her performance at the 2024 Olympics , where she became the first Indian woman shooter to win an Olympics medal by winning a bronze in the 10m pistol event. [ 2 ]
Around 2012, Jaspal Rana started coaching several Indian sport shooters, and since 2018 he has been coaching Olympic medalist Manu Bhaker. [1] [4] Rana has been credited for helping Bhaker win double bronze medals at the 2024 Paris Olympics. [5] Rana also coaches at the Jaspal Rana Institute of Education and Technology in Dehradun.

The Khel Ratna Award (Hindi pronunciation: [kʰeːl rət̪nə]), officially known as the Major Dhyan Chand Khel Ratna Award (transl. Major Dhyan Chand Sport Jewel Award) or formerly known as the Rajiv Gandhi Khel Ratna Award, is the highest sporting honour of India. [1]

Saurabh Chaudhary (born 12 May 2002) is an Indian sport shooter. [2] He won the gold medal at the 2018 Asian Games in 10 m air pistol and became the youngest Indian gold medalist to do so. [3]
